Transaction 0012187439b4911028cb1a1125348eb78798370f1e57489f5c01af34b91f5157

2 Input
1 Outputs
  • 0012187439b4911028cb1a1125348eb78798370f1e57489f5c01af34b91f5157:0
  • value  68887612
    address  3BcdP5ZyvmsCw2cqwDf5oYs4HnozVkFwZc